Dubai Technology Partners and Quintiq announce partnership for MENA

Dubai Technology Partners LLC (DTP), the region’s leading business consultancy and systems integrator for the aviation industry, has announced that it is has signed a partnership agreement with Quintiq, a Dassault Systèmes company and global leader in supply chain planning and optimisation (SCP&O).

Since 2004, DTP has acquired extensive knowledge and skills to cater to the continuously evolving airport technology requirements. Due to the rapid growth of the aviation industry in the MENA region, this strategic alliance will allow DTP to extend its solution offering and provide its aviation customers with Quintiq’s innovative planning and optimisation solutions that will help to improve operations efficiency, increase productivity and ultimately positively impact passenger satisfaction and retention.

“We collaborated with Quintiq in 2017 to deliver planning solutions to one of the biggest hub airports in the world to manage its fixed resources, including airport stands, gates, baggage belts and check-in counters,” said Abdul Razzak Mikati, Managing Director at DTP.

“That successful implementation has improved the airport’s overall efficiency, reliability and passenger satisfaction. Through that collaboration, we recognised our complementary capabilities and synergies, and collectively, we believe that the formalisation of our partnership will result in the delivery of much-needed, high-tech aviation optimisation solutions to stakeholders across the region.”

Henk De Bruin, Director Delivery, EMEAR at Quintiq, added: “DTP has impressed us with over a decade’s experience in aviation know-how, project management, delivery capability and high standards of service quality.

“On merit, DTP is our clear choice for a strong partnership in order to further strengthen Quintiq’s presence in the Middle East and North Africa’s aviation market. Our shared vision, goals and expertise will allow us to make day-to-day business easier for airports, airlines, ground handlers and ATCs and in doing so, set the highest industry standard.”
